The latest developments in Enterprise kit helped the top teams at the Enterprise Inland Championships held at Northampton Sailing Club on the 24th and 25th April.
Tim Sadler and Salty got to grips with the new Fly Away jib sticks (available in a kit from P&B) and won the first race, but it was Tim’s daughter Hannah and Alan Johnson who took first overall. Alan has been helping the P&B loft to further our Enterprise sail development and it seems to be working.
Overall Results:
1st Alan Johnson & Hannah Sadler (SCYC) - P&B sails
2nd Tim Sadler & Richard Sault (Yorkshire Dales) - P&B sails
4th David & Alex Beaney (Castaways) - P&B sails

Flying Fifteens
At the Flying Fifteen Northern Championships held at Derwent Reservoir, David McKee & Chris Hewkin revelled in the generally light and very variable conditions. They thrashed the opposition by recording 4 wins out of 5 races and taking the Northern Championships, various trophies and a crate of champagne to celebrate with, on a total of 4 points. Amazing!
David and Chris were using the latest cut of sails developed and made in the P&B loft.
